Individuals are missing out on money that may comfort them.

Child benefit and assistance with council tax costs are among the estimated £13 billion in benefits that go unclaimed.

According to EntitledTo, around five million people are believed to be missing out on the money.

The most common benefit that goes unclaimed is council tax relief, with over three million people missing out on £2.7 billion in total.

Local councils provide council tax assistance, which can range from a discount on your bill to paying nothing at all, depending on your circumstances.

Around half a million families are expected to be missing out on little under £1 billion in child benefit, despite the fact that some eligible families opt not to claim.

When parents earn more than £50,000, they must refund some or all of the child benefit they get.

Meanwhile, more than half a million low-income retirees are eligible for additional state pension supplements.

Unclaimed Pension Credit is worth £1.47 billion, and individuals may get thousands of pounds per year.

EntitledTo’s predictions are based on the most recent data available from the government as well as its own computations.
